Women's Soccer: In the third round of the OK Green Tournament, Holland traveled to Grand Rapids Union and came away with a 4-4 tie. After the Red Hawks opened with a goal, Dee Rumpsa got a through ball from Emma Margaron to tie the score. After halftime, new varsity forward Lesly Garcia scored two goals to push the lead to 3-1. Unfortunately, the Dutch could not hold the lead, and Union scored three straight goals to take the lead. In the last two minutes of the game, Lesly Garcia won a ball in the box and scored preserving the 4-4 tie. "The game was a high-scoring affair," said Holland coach Greg Ceithaml. "Union battle hard, and I was happy with the way our team fought. Losing a 3-1 lead was difficult mentally. It was great to see the team respond so intensely." Holland is now 4-7-4. In JV action, the Holland JV fell to Union 2-0.
Softball: The Holland Varsity Softball team traveled to South Christian to take on the Sailors. Both teams displayed great pitching and defensive efforts in a pitcher's dual. With little offense, it came down to who would score last. With both teams tied at 1 run a piece going into the 4th inning, Holland scored 2 runs to take a 3-1 lead. With a 2 run lead in the bottom of the 7th inning, Holland was unable to hold the Sailors from scoring which led to South Christian taking the victory 4-3. Holland coach Rick Harris said, "It was a fun game to coach and watch. Both teams played great defense and hit the ball well. I wish all games could go this way, win or lose. Although we fell short of the dub today, we know we played a great team and we got better. We'll use the next two weeks of the regular season to continue to improve and prepare for the state tournament." Holland will travel to Ottawa Hills this Saturday for the Ottawa Hills Tournament.
Women's Track and Field: On warm cloudy Thursday afternoon and evening in Fremont, the girls' track team took an amazing 4th place at the D2 Regional Meet with 54 points. Many athletes got PR’s on a competitive track, here are the Regional medal winners. Two girls claimed an individual second place medal and assured themselves of a trip to the State Meet in Hamilton. They are Madalyn Daniels in the 200m Dash (26.36)PR/SQ and Alba Rodriguez in the High Jump (5-1) PR/SQ. They are going to the State Meet because they are REGIONAL runner-ups. AWESOME! Alba Rodriguez-Lima took 3rd in the 100M Hurdles (16.31)SQ and Miona Rodgers took home an individual 4th place medal in the 200m (26.72)PR/SQ. Those times punched their tickets to the STATE Meet also. Congratulations Alba and Miona! Additional medal winners and point getters were: Madalyn Daniels took 3rd in the 100m dash(12.97). Medaling for 4th place and kicking it in the 4x100m Relay team of Miona Rodgers, Kaylie Clark, Makayla Clark and Madalyn Daniels (51.96)PR. Johanna Mulder took 4th in the 1600m (5:30.93) and 7th in the 800m (2:32.96). Miona Rodgers also medaled for 5th place in the 100m (13.30). Medaling for 6th place was the 4x200m Relay team of Amiyah Guy, Kaylie Clark, Miriam Lopez-Koolhaas and Miona Rodgers (1:53.76). Alba Rodriguez-Lima in the 300 hurdles took 7th place (51.44). Miriam Lopez-Koolhaas took 8th place in the 100 hurdles (17.76). Madalyn, Alba and Miona will represent HHS at the State Meet at Hamilton High School on June 1.
Men's Track and Field: Noah Lambers continued his stellar season by qualifying for the state meet in the 1600m and 3200m races. Lambers placed 2nd in the 1600m (4:23.15), automatically qualifying for the state finals by place and time. Lambers also qualified in the 3200m (9:43.52) and placed 4th in the event. Willem Evenson will also be competing at the State Finals in the Pole Vault. Before today, Evenson's best vault was still 2 inches short of the automatic qualifying height. But this senior's hard work paid off at the right time. Willem cleared the automatic qualifying height of 12' 8" on his first attempt. He followed that up with huge vaults clearing 13' 0", 13' 3", and 13' 6". When the event ended, Willem Evenson walked away as the Regional Champion in the pole vault. Although only Lambers and Evenson qualified for state, several teammates hit PRs as their season came to a close. Every Holland relay team ran their best times of the season today.
